For Speech-Language Pathologists, neurologists, primary care physicians, rehabilitation professionals, and interdisciplinary healthcare teams, dysphagia management extends well beyond the swallowing assessment. While instrumental evaluations and evidence-based interventions remain the foundation of care, the ultimate measure of success is whether an individual can safely and consistently implement clinical recommendations in everyday life.

This implementation gap is one of the greatest yet least discussed challenges in dysphagia management.

Patients may understand compensatory strategies, comply during therapy sessions, and demonstrate safe swallowing under supervised conditions. Yet once they return home, maintaining hydration, adhering to modified liquid recommendations, self-feeding independently, and participating in daily mealtimes often become significantly more difficult.

As clinicians continue shifting toward person-centered models of care, greater attention should be given to adaptive intake technologies that may help support the practical application of swallowing recommendations outside the clinical setting.

Looking Beyond Aspiration


Historically, dysphagia management has appropriately focused on aspiration prevention and pulmonary protection. However, recent literature increasingly recognizes that swallowing health also encompasses hydration, nutrition, medication management, participation, caregiver burden, and health-related quality of life.

The multinational consensus on dysphagia in Parkinson's disease emphasizes that swallowing surveillance should extend beyond aspiration detection to include earlier recognition of functional swallowing changes and proactive management strategies. Cosentino G, Avenali M, Schindler A, et al. A multinational consensus on dysphagia in Parkinson's disease: screening, diagnosis and prognostic value. Journal of Neurology. 2022.

Similarly, Mozzanica and colleagues demonstrated that reduced tongue strength and endurance were associated with poorer oral phase efficiency, reduced meal performance, and increased malnutrition risk in individuals living with Parkinson's disease, reinforcing the importance of evaluating functional swallowing outcomes in addition to aspiration risk. Mozzanica F, et al. Tongue strength and endurance in Parkinson's disease. Dysphagia. 2025.

Collectively, these studies support an evolving understanding of dysphagia management that prioritizes functional oral intake, hydration, participation, and quality of life alongside airway protection.

The Role of Assistive Technology


Despite remarkable advances in dysphagia assessment and rehabilitation, comparatively little attention has been given to adaptive intake systems that help patients implement swallowing recommendations throughout their daily routines.

For many individuals living with neurological disease, drinking from a conventional cup presents multiple challenges that extend beyond swallowing physiology.

These commonly include:

  • reduced oral motor control
  • tremor
  • upper extremity weakness
  • impaired hand coordination
  • arthritis
  • reduced cervical mobility
  • fatigue
  • caregiver dependence
  • anxiety surrounding drinking

Even when swallowing recommendations are clinically appropriate, these functional barriers may contribute to reduced hydration, prolonged mealtimes, decreased independence, and lower adherence to prescribed compensatory strategies.

Adaptive intake systems should therefore be viewed not as simple drinking vessels, but as assistive technologies that may help support accessibility, independence, and person-centered participation.

Supporting Person-Centered Care


Modern rehabilitation increasingly emphasizes participation alongside impairment reduction.

The World Health Organization's International Classification of Functioning, Disability and Health (ICF) encourages clinicians to evaluate activity, participation, and environmental factors in addition to body structure and function.

Within dysphagia management, this means asking not only whether swallowing is physiologically safer, but also whether individuals can successfully implement recommendations in everyday life.

Adaptive intake systems represent one practical strategy for helping bridge this gap.
